Output 86bc297956d753ca4a506434c4779e8ec192303fc96e85211ad4a019b9956039:1

value
372199140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d25134de8f53e8dcda445e3b3fe1865ee5620c OP_EQUAL
address
323DuDSpHP4HcpbszozA2yvRKzBwJLNa53
transaction
86bc297956d753ca4a506434c4779e8ec192303fc96e85211ad4a019b9956039
spent
true